- (a) All pleadings filed by any party relating to any contested proceeding pending or to be instituted before the department shall be filed with the hearings clerk, and if appropriate, the SOAH. A pleading shall be deemed filed only when actually received.
- (b) A copy of any pleading filed by any party in any proceeding, subsequent to the institution thereof, shall be mailed or otherwise delivered by the party filing the same to every other party, or such party's attorney of record not less than five days before the time specified for the hearing.
- (c) Deposit in the United States mail of a registered or certified letter, return receipt requested, or mailing by commercial carrier such as Federal Express, addressed to the affected party or the attorney of record for the party and sent to the party's last known address, or if a party is a licensee, the last address shown by the records of the department, or the attorney's last known address, shall constitute service of the pleading. The date of deposit as hereinabove provided is the date of the act, after which any designated period of time begins to run as provided in §1.6 of this title (relating to Computation and Enlargement of Time).
- (d) Service may also be accomplished by telephonic document transfer (fax). Service by telephonic document transfer is complete when sent to the recipient's current telecopier number. Service by telephonic document transfer after 5:00 p.m. local time of the recipient shall be deemed served on the following day.
- (e) The willful failure of any party to make such service shall be sufficient grounds for the entry of an order by the administrative law judge, striking the protest, reply, answer, motion, or other pleading from the record.
- (f) A certificate by the party, attorney, or representative who files a pleading, stating that it has been served on the other parties, shall be prima facie evidence of such service. The following form of certificate will be sufficient in this connection: "I hereby certify that a copy of this (state name of pleading) was sent by (state manner of service) to each addressee listed below on ________________________. Signature."
